This is an exciting opportunity to lead McDonald's UK & Ireland's New Build Construction team, driving the development and delivery of new restaurants. As Head of New Build Construction, you'll oversee high-profile builds, manage a team of senior project managers, and work with franchisees, developers, and supply chain partners to ensure best-in-class execution.
What you’ll be doing:
- Lead and mentor the New Build Team, developing and managing senior project managers.
- Oversee end-to-end construction delivery, from site evaluation to final project handover.
- Optimise supply chain performance, ensuring efficiency and quality in construction projects.
- Collaborate with key stakeholders, including franchisees, developers, and corporate leadership.
- Ensure compliance with planning laws, health & safety standards, and McDonald's policies.
- Drive continuous improvement, enhancing processes and construction capabilities.
What we are looking for:
- Strong leadership and people management skills, with a focus on development and succession planning.
- 10+ years of project management experience in new builds or commercial fit-outs.
- Industry experience in restaurants, retail, hospitality, or leisure.
- Membership in RICS, CIOB, or APM (essential).
- Expert financial management and budgeting for large-scale construction projects.
- Exceptional negotiation and stakeholder engagement abilities.
